T.16000M FCS (Flight Control System) Exclusive precision: H.E.A.R.T HallEffect AccuRate Technology™! 3D (Hall Effect) magnetic sensors located on the stick:

precision levels 256 times greater than current systems (i.e. resolution of 16000 x 16000 values!)
magnets ensure friction-free action for razor-sharp precision that won't decrease over time
helical spring (0.1" / 2.8 mm in diameter) inside the stick providing firm, linear and smooth tension

Fully ambidextrous joysticks set!

3 removable components allow each joystick to be perfectly tailored for left-handed or right-handed use
piloting with a joystick in each hand is now possible in all games compatible with two joysticks at the same time

16 action buttons with "braille"-style physical button identification!

12 on the base and 4 on the stick
one 8-way Point of View hat switch
switch allowing users to configure the 12 buttons located on the base in a left- or right-handed position

4 independent axis, including twist rudder (controlled by rotating the stick)
Ergonomic trigger for brake (civilian flight) or rapid fire (military flight and space simulation) control
Multidirectional hat switch (for panoramic view)
Ergonomic design for optimum comfort
Wide hand rest for reduced stress
Weighted base for enhanced stability


Box contents:

2 T.16000M FCS joysticks, 2 replacement thumb rests, 2 replacement index finger rests, user manual and consumer warranty information.

T.A.R.G.E.T programming software: program up to 256 buttons on the joystick (buttons merged from keyboard and mouse)

Thrustmaster Advanced pRogramming Graphical EdiTor software: combine with other Thrustmaster devices (so that they are recognized as a single USB device), and load or create specific mapping profiles for each game.
